The FDA is warning consumers and tattoo artists about two contaminated Sacred Tattoo Ink lots. The inks, Raven Black and Sunny Daze, were found to contain bacteria, including Pseudomonas aeruginosa.

The Environmental Protection Authority (EPA) is seeking information about how tattoo inks are supplied, made and used in New Zealand to help assess whether the current rules are fit for purpose.
